xpna integrates with Power BI, the leading data visualization tool from Microsoft that empowers users to transform data into stunning visuals and share insights across their organization.

When connecting xpna to Power BI, you can leverage its powerful features such as real-time dashboards and interactive reports, to enhance your data analysis experience.

With this integration, users can extend the ways in which they can monitor key metrics, identify trends, and make informed decisions.

Once access to Power BI is granted at the workspace level, subscription administrators can fine-tune permissions by selectively enabling individual users.

It is recommended to consult with your organization's IT department regarding your Power BI license status.

Users with a Power BI Pro license within their organization can take advantage of the Power BI Desktop app to establish a connection to the xpna service. This enables them to create and customize Power BI reports, harnessing the full potential of their data for more insightful analysis. By utilizing the Power BI Desktop app, users can explore various visualization options, apply advanced analytics, and share their reports with others in their organization.

On the other hand, users without a Power BI Pro license are typically assigned a Free Power BI license, which allows them to view and interact with the reports created by others. While they may not have the capability to create reports themselves, they can still benefit from the insights provided by the shared reports. This ensures that all team members, regardless of their license type, can access valuable data insights to inform their decision-making.
